Centre has a vacancy for a Paralegal / Legal Assistant II. In this role, you will be supporting the overall mission of the Money Laundering and Asset Recovery Section (MLARS) . Responsibilities

  • Assists attorney in reviewing case material, to include gathering and analyzing case material and preparing a digest of selected decisions / opinions, including legal references. May provide Legal Clerk review.
  • Drafts, edits, and reviews non-legal information, creates correspondence, and research reports.
  • Helps prepare for trial by organizing exhibits and assists in creating and organizing statistical charts and photographs.
  • Interviews potential witnesses and prepares summary interview reports.
  • Reviews prepared legal documents to confirm the citations and legal references included in the documents.
  • Attends pre-trial meetings to review case materials for missing documents or other questionable material and may request further information to correct deficiencies.
  • After / during trial prepares summaries of testimony and depositions.
  • Investigates facts and laws of cases and searches public records to prepare cases and determine causes of action, as well as research reports and correspondence relating to cases.
  • Performs other duties as assigned. Requirements

  • Ability to work in a team environment, deliver the highest quality of work, and maintain a professional disposition under extreme pressure This position requires U.S. Citizenship and a 7 (or 10) year minimum background investigation Agency Overview The Money Laundering and Asset Recovery Section (MLARS) leads the asset forfeiture and anti-money laundering enforcement efforts. MLARS holds the responsibility of coordination, direction, and general oversight of the Asset Recovery Program.MLARS provides leadership by prosecuting and coordinating complex, sensitive, multi-district, and international money laundering and asset forfeiture investigations and cases; by providing legal and policy assistance and training to federal, state, and local prosecutors and law enforcement personnel, as well as to foreign governments; by assisting Departmental and interagency policymakers by developing and reviewing legislative, regulatory, and policy initiatives; and by managing the Department's Asset Forfeiture Program, including distributing forfeited funds and properties to appropriate domestic and foreign law enforcement agencies and to community groups within the United States, as well as adjudicating petitions for remission or mitigation of forfeited assets.
